Katsuura vs Uzgorod Climate & Distance Between

Ukraine flag
  • The distance between Katsuura, Japan and Uzgorod, Ukraine is approximately 8,868 km or 5,510 mi.
  • To reach Katsuura in this distance one would set out from Uzgorod bearing 47.2°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Katsuura bearing 143.7° or SE .
  • Katsuura has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Uzgorod has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
  • Katsuura is in or near the warm temperate wet forest biome whereas Uzgorod is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
  • The average temperature is 5.7 °C (10.3°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 3.5 °C (6.3°F) less in Katsuura. The continentality subtype is semicontinental as opposed to subcontinental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 1172.1 mm (46.1 in) more which is equivalent to 1172.1 l/m² (28.77 US gal/ft²) or 11,721,000 l/ha (1,253,053 US gal/ac) more. About 2 3/5 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 13.4° higher in Katsuura than in Uzgorod.
